Minimizing overgrown plants is a crucial element of landscape management, helping to restore order, enhance visual appeals,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can limit airflow, lower sunshine penetration, and develop opportunities for bugs and illness. Pruning and thinning are the primary methods for managing dense or rowdy plants, permitting plants to flourish while keeping a regulated look. The process includes selectively eliminating excess branches, stems, and foliage, always considering the natural growth routine of each types. Timing is essential; some plants react best to pruning during dormancy, while flowering ranges may need post-bloom trimming to preserve blooms. Appropriate technique ensures cuts are clean and located to motivate healthy new development. In addition to enhancing plant health, lowering overgrowth enhances availability and presence in the landscape Paths, driveways, and outdoor home end up being safer and more inviting. Long-term maintenance strategies prevent future overgrowth, guaranteeing a well balanced and unified landscape.
